博客 基于多云架构的跨云迁移技术实现与优化方案

基于多云架构的跨云迁移技术实现与优化方案

   数栈君   发表于 2025-10-19 12:14  133  0

基于多云架构的跨云迁移技术实现与优化方案

在数字化转型的浪潮中,企业越来越依赖云计算技术来支持其业务发展。然而,随着业务的扩展和需求的变化,单一云平台的局限性逐渐显现。多云架构因其灵活性、可靠性和成本优化的优势,成为企业云战略的重要选择。跨云迁移作为实现多云架构的关键技术,帮助企业将数据、应用和资源从一个云平台迁移到另一个云平台或多个云平台,从而实现资源的最优配置和业务的持续发展。

本文将深入探讨跨云迁移的技术实现与优化方案,为企业在多云架构下的迁移过程提供实用的指导和建议。


一、跨云迁移的背景与意义

  1. 多云架构的兴起多云架构是指企业同时使用多个云平台(如AWS、Azure、阿里云等)来构建其 IT 基础设施。这种架构能够充分利用各云平台的优势,避免单一云平台的限制,同时提高系统的可靠性和容错能力。

  2. 跨云迁移的必要性在实际应用中,企业可能由于业务需求变化、成本优化、技术升级等原因,需要将现有资源从一个云平台迁移到另一个云平台。跨云迁移能够帮助企业实现资源的灵活调配,同时降低对单一云平台的依赖风险。

  3. 跨云迁移的核心挑战跨云迁移涉及复杂的流程,包括数据迁移、应用适配、网络架构调整等。这些过程需要考虑数据一致性、迁移时间、成本控制以及安全合规等多个方面。


二、跨云迁移的技术实现

  1. 数据迁移的实现数据迁移是跨云迁移的核心任务之一。以下是其实现的关键步骤:

    • 数据评估:在迁移前,需要对数据的规模、类型和依赖关系进行全面评估,以确定适合的迁移策略。
    • 数据抽取:使用工具从源云平台中提取数据,并确保数据的完整性和一致性。
    • 数据转换:根据目标云平台的要求,对数据进行格式转换和清洗。
    • 数据加载:将处理后的数据加载到目标云平台,并验证数据的准确性和可用性。
  2. 应用迁移的实现应用迁移涉及将运行在源云平台上的应用程序迁移到目标云平台。关键步骤包括:

    • 应用评估:分析应用的依赖关系、性能需求和兼容性问题。
    • 应用重构:根据目标云平台的特性,对应用进行必要的代码修改和架构优化。
    • 应用部署:使用目标云平台的部署工具(如容器化技术)将应用部署到目标环境中。
    • 应用验证:通过测试确保应用在目标云平台上的稳定性和性能。
  3. 网络架构的调整跨云迁移通常伴随着网络架构的调整。企业需要重新设计网络拓扑,以确保数据在多云环境中的高效流动。关键点包括:

    • 带宽优化:通过优化网络带宽和使用压缩技术,减少数据传输的时间和成本。
    • 延迟控制:通过分布式架构和边缘计算技术,降低数据传输的延迟。
    • 安全防护:在跨云迁移过程中,需要加强数据传输的安全性,防止数据泄露和攻击。
  4. 数据同步与一致性在跨云迁移过程中,数据一致性是一个重要问题。企业需要确保源云平台和目标云平台之间的数据同步,避免数据丢失或不一致。常用方法包括:

    • 增量同步:仅传输数据的增量部分,减少数据传输量。
    • 校验机制:在数据传输完成后,通过校验算法验证数据的完整性。
    • 实时监控:在迁移过程中实时监控数据传输状态,及时发现和解决问题。

三、跨云迁移的优化方案

  1. 并行传输技术通过并行传输技术,可以同时传输多个数据块,从而提高数据迁移的效率。这种方法特别适用于大规模数据迁移场景。

  2. 压缩算法优化使用高效的压缩算法(如Gzip、Snappy)对数据进行压缩,可以显著减少数据传输量,从而降低传输时间和成本。

  3. 错误处理与恢复机制在数据传输过程中,可能会出现网络中断、数据损坏等问题。通过引入错误处理和恢复机制(如断点续传、数据校验),可以确保迁移过程的稳定性和可靠性。

  4. 监控与反馈机制在迁移过程中,实时监控数据传输的状态和性能指标,并根据反馈结果动态调整迁移策略,以优化迁移效率。


四、跨云迁移的挑战与解决方案

  1. 数据一致性问题数据在迁移过程中可能会出现不一致的情况,导致目标云平台上的数据与源云平台上的数据不匹配。解决方案包括使用校验机制和增量同步技术。

  2. 迁移时间过长对于大规模数据迁移,迁移时间可能会非常长,影响企业的业务连续性。解决方案包括使用并行传输技术和优化网络带宽。

  3. 成本控制问题跨云迁移涉及大量的计算资源和存储资源,可能会导致成本过高。解决方案包括使用压缩算法优化数据传输量和选择合适的迁移工具。

  4. 安全与合规问题数据在迁移过程中可能会面临安全风险,导致数据泄露或被攻击。解决方案包括使用加密技术、安全传输协议和合规认证。


五、跨云迁移的实际案例

以下是一个典型的跨云迁移案例:某企业计划将其数据从AWS迁移到阿里云。在迁移过程中,企业首先对数据进行了全面评估,并选择了合适的迁移工具。然后,企业通过并行传输技术和压缩算法优化了数据传输效率,确保了数据的完整性和一致性。最后,企业通过实时监控和反馈机制,动态调整了迁移策略,成功完成了数据迁移。


六、跨云迁移的未来趋势

  1. 智能化迁移工具随着人工智能和机器学习技术的发展,智能化迁移工具将成为跨云迁移的重要趋势。这些工具能够自动分析数据和应用的特性,并推荐最优的迁移策略。

  2. 自动化迁移流程未来的跨云迁移将更加自动化,通过自动化工具和脚本,实现迁移过程的全自动化,从而提高迁移效率和减少人为错误。

  3. 多云协同优化随着多云架构的普及,跨云迁移将更加注重多云环境下的协同优化,通过多云平台的协同工作,实现资源的最优配置和业务的高效运行。

  4. 数据主权与合规性随着数据主权和合规性要求的提高,跨云迁移将更加注重数据的安全性和合规性,确保数据在迁移过程中的安全性和合法性。


七、申请试用 & https://www.dtstack.com/?src=bbs

如果您对跨云迁移技术感兴趣,或者希望了解更多关于多云架构的解决方案,可以申请试用相关工具和服务。通过实践和探索,您将能够更好地理解和掌握跨云迁移的核心技术与优化方案。

申请试用 & https://www.dtstack.com/?src=bbs


通过本文的介绍,我们希望能够为企业在多云架构下的跨云迁移提供有价值的参考和指导。无论是技术实现还是优化方案,跨云迁移都需要企业投入大量的资源和精力,但其带来的灵活性、可靠性和成本优化将为企业带来长期的收益。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料